Tile and Stone Setters vs. First-Line Supervisors of Construction Trades and Extraction Workers: Who Earns More?
First-Line Supervisors of Construction Trades and Extraction Workerss out-earn Tile and Stone Setterss by $24K a year at the national median, per BLS OEWS May 2025. Tile and Stone Setterss land at $55,690 and First-Line Supervisors of Construction Trades and Extraction Workerss at $79,920. Top-paying state for Tile and Stone Setterss is Massachusetts ($81,150); for First-Line Supervisors of Construction Trades and Extraction Workerss it's Washington ($109,570).
